nginx的日志通常都是一個(gè)文件寫到底,想要按天分割日志一般都是使用腳本執(zhí)行日志改名和nginx進(jìn)程重啟來實(shí)現(xiàn)的。但是使用腳本進(jìn)行日志分割還要配合定時(shí)任務(wù),能不能讓nginx直接按天輸出日志呢?還真有。
具體實(shí)現(xiàn)原理是將日期賦值給變量,然后使用變量名來命名日志文件名,然后就可以在不重啟nginx的情況下讓nginx自動(dòng)按天來輸出日志了。具體實(shí)現(xiàn)方式如下:
也可以修改正則的部分,把年月日的變量分開:
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請(qǐng)聯(lián)系作者





暫無評(píng)論,快來評(píng)論吧!